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Lära Skapa Data med POST | Sektion
Arbete med MongoDB i Expressapplikationer

bookSkapa Data med POST

Svep för att visa menyn

För att lagra data i MongoDB skapar du ett nytt dokument med hjälp av en modell.

Detta görs vanligtvis i en POST-rutt.

app.post('/users', async (req, res) => {
  const user = new User(req.body);

  const savedUser = await user.save();

  res.json(savedUser);
});

Data kommer från req.body. En ny instans av modellen skapas och sparas sedan i databasen.

Efter att ha sparats returneras det lagrade dokumentet som ett svar.

Exempel på request body:

{ "name": "John", "age": 25 }

Detta skapar en ny post i databasen.

question mark

Vad gör user.save()?

Vänligen välj det korrekta svaret

Var allt tydligt?

Hur kan vi förbättra det?

Tack för dina kommentarer!

Avsnitt 1. Kapitel 7

Fråga AI

expand

Fråga AI

ChatGPT

Fråga vad du vill eller prova någon av de föreslagna frågorna för att starta vårt samtal

Avsnitt 1. Kapitel 7
some-alt